This designer villa stands above Donja Lastva in Tivat, on roughly 4,200 square metres of ground with an open view across the Bay of Tivat to the coast and the mountains. It is built in local stone in the regional manner, so it sits into the hillside rather than on top of it. Seven bedrooms, five levels, and at the centre of the garden an olive tree thought to be eight hundred to a thousand years old. Price on application.

The Villa

The villa runs to about 1,400 square metres gross, with 791 of living space across five levels joined by a private lift. The ground floor centres on a large reception with a separate entertainment area, an open kitchen and dining, and service rooms. The master, on the first floor, has a Jacuzzi and a full view across the bay. Above that, a covered rooftop terrace takes in the whole panorama, set apart from the main living rooms for quiet evenings and open-air dinners.

Wellness and the Guest Apartment

The lower level, about 315 square metres, is given over to wellness: a gym, sauna, hammam, cold plunge, massage room and a cinema. There are two pools, one indoor and a 99 square metre pool outside, with terraces, an outdoor kitchen and several places to sit. A separate second-floor apartment of around 137 square metres, with its own terrace, gives guests or staff genuine independence.

The Grounds

The planting follows the same logic as the house. Aromatic and decorative species, mature fruit trees and established olive groves shape the terraces, with the ancient olive at the centre. A 42 square metre garage, further parking and a full security system handle the practical side.

Donja Lastva and Tivat

Donja Lastva is one of the most sought addresses in Tivat, quieter than the marina centre but tied straight into the Bay of Tivat. The sea is about 500 metres away, Tivat town around 1.5 kilometres, and Porto Montenegro's marina roughly ten minutes by car. Tivat airport is close, which makes the villa workable for a season or a long stay.

The Market Case

Tivat has become one of the leading addresses on the Adriatic, anchored by Porto Montenegro, and large private plots with mature grounds this close to the marina are hard to find. Coastal prices have risen roughly 15 percent since 2023, foreign buyers make up around two thirds of purchases, and Montenegro is targeting EU accession around 2028. The country uses the euro, charges no capital gains tax on property held beyond two years, and lets non-residents own outright.
